As far as I know you can buy a higher level plan. Not sure about a lower level one as it would mean you couldn’t afford breakfast in your own hotel.
You can certainly use them at face value, though you lose your drink I think. I haven’t had a dining plan for a while but last time we did it, the face value of the dinner voucher was the same price as a buffet. Looking on the site, the Plus menus are €42 mostly, although Yacht Club is €47.99 The Plus plan is €57 so basically you’re paying about €16 for a breakfast that can cost you a lot more than that. At the end of the day though, it’s what suits you.
